ABOUT NIKKI
Nikki is a 2-year-old shy but incredibly sweet lady who came to HAP from a high-intake shelter in the South when they no longer had space for her. While her past is unknown, Nikki has shown herself to be a gentle, loving soul who just needs time and patience to feel safe. She can be timid at first and takes a bit to warm up, but beneath that shyness is a truly special girl. Nikki appears to be house-trained, patiently waiting to go outside and keeping her kennel clean. She's calm and well-mannered, tolerant of handling, and does wonderfully with our team, allowing us to build her confidence. She hasn't been destructive in her kennel and seems dog friendly through barriers, though she'll need slow, proper introductions. Every now and then, her personality shines through with adorable zoomies, especially in the snow, which she loves. With patience, understanding, and a quiet home, Nikki will make a deeply rewarding companion!
